Advantages of Aluminium Windows and Doors

Aluminium windows and doors included a myriad of benefits. Here are a few of the most notable advantages:

  1. Durability: Aluminium is understood for its strength and resilience. Unlike wood, it does not warp or rot and can hold up against severe climate condition.
  2. Low Maintenance: With a basic wipe-down, aluminium doors and windows can keep their look without any unique cleaning options or treatments.
  3. Energy Efficiency: Modern aluminium frames have improved thermal performance, with multi-chambered styles that prevent heat transfer, hence lowering energy expenses.
  4. Versatility: Available in a variety of styles, colours, and finishes, aluminium windows and doors can suit any architectural style, from contemporary to standard.
  5. High Security: Aluminium is a strong product which, when combined with innovative locking systems, improves the security of homes and buildings.

Style and Aesthetic Options

Aluminium windows and doors are offered in various styles and surfaces, enabling house owners to reveal their individual design. Some popular alternatives consist of:

  • Sliding Doors: Perfect for mixing indoor and outside living spaces, they provide expansive views and smooth shifts.
  • Bi-Fold Doors: Ideal for creating broad openings, they can fold and stack to the side.
  • Sash Windows: Hinged on one side, supplying outstanding ventilation and views.
  • Awning Windows: Hinged from the top to permit ventilation while keeping rain out.
  • Set Windows: Ideal for large openings where ventilation is not needed.

Aluminium can also be powder-coated, enabling unlimited personalization in regards to colour and finish. Homeowners can match doors and windows to their existing design for a cohesive appearance.

Installation Process

The setup of aluminium doors and windows can be complex, needing professional proficiency to guarantee the best results. Here is a basic overview of the setup procedure:

  1. Measurement: Accurate measurements of the existing frames or openings are vital to make sure the new setups fit completely.
  2. Preparation: The proper tools and products must be gathered, including the windows or doors, screws, and sealants.
  3. Removal of Old Frames: If replacing existing windows, cautious removal of old frames is necessary without destructive surrounding structures.
  4. Setup of New Frames: The aluminium frames are set up and secured in location.
  5. Sealing and Finishing: Once set up, the frames are sealed to ensure airtightness, followed by any required completing.

It's advisable to seek advice from a professional installer to ensure right fitting and performance.

Maintenance Tips

While aluminium doors and windows are low-maintenance, they do require some upkeep to lengthen their life and appearance. Here are some upkeep tips:

  • Regular Cleaning: Wipe down frames with a soft fabric and moderate cleaning agent to keep them tidy. Avoid abrasive products that can scratch the surface.
  • Inspect Seals: Regularly inspect seals for wear, and change them if essential to make sure energy performance.
  • Lube Moving Parts: Apply a weather-resistant lube to hinges and locks to make sure smooth operation.
  • Inspect for Damage: Periodically look for dents, scratches, or any signs of corrosion, and address problems immediately.

Often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. Are aluminium doors and windows energy-efficient?

Yes, contemporary aluminium windows and doors are designed with thermal breaks and multi-chambered frames that substantially enhance their energy effectiveness.

2. For how long can I anticipate my aluminium windows and doors to last?

With proper upkeep, aluminium windows and doors can last for numerous decades, making them a durable option for property and business properties.

3. Do aluminium doors and windows require painting?

No, they do not need painting due to their powder-coated surfaces, which are highly durable and resistant to fading.

4. Can I personalize the colour of my aluminium windows and doors?

Yes, aluminium doors and windows can be powder-coated in a variety of colours, permitting for comprehensive modification to match your home's design.

5. Are aluminium windows and doors eco-friendly?

Yes, aluminium is a recyclable product. When replaced, old frames can be recycled, reducing waste in garbage dumps.
